The paper describes a fuzzy decisionmalung approach to controlling thermal comfort in the occupied zones of an airconditioned building. The control objective is defined in terms of fuzzy goals and fuzzy cost functions and a fuzzy decision-maker is used to find the most appropriate control action. Simulation results are presented that demonstrate the performance of the comfort control scheme when it is used in different types of buildings. The results show that computing resources need not be wasted on calculating precise values for the control signal, when the control objective is poorly defined.
